These high‑quality Coarse Iron Metal Filings are supplied in a generous 3kg pack and manufactured to Laboratory Reagent (LR) Grade standards. With CAS No. 7439‑89‑6, this material is ideal for a broad range of magnetic and physical science demonstrations commonly used across school laboratories.
Iron filings are an essential classroom resource for exploring magnetism, magnetic field patterns, and attraction/repulsion forces. Their coarse size makes them easy to handle, reusable, and perfect for both teacher demonstrations and hands‑on student investigations.
